The exterior design is a practical version based on XQuery functions. The method is declarative because the integration reasoning is specified in a top-level languagethe combination query is created in XQuery when it comes to ODSI. As a result of this method, intend the resulting function is ultimately called from a question such as the complying with, which can either originate from an application or from an additional information solution specified in addition to this: for $cust in ics: obtain, All, Customers( )where $cust/State='Rhode Island'return $cust/Name In this situation, the information services platform can translucent the function interpretation as well as optimize the inquiry's implementation by fetching just Rhode Island clients from the relational information resource and also fetching only the orders for those clients from the order management service to compute the response.

In addition, notice that the question does not request all data for customers; instead, it only requests their names. Since of this, another optimization is possible: The engine can answer the question by bring only the names of the Rhode Island clients from the relational source and also altogether avoid any type of order administration system calls.

Information obstructs stay in buckets, which can list their material and also are additionally the unit of gain access to control. Containers are treated as subdomains of s3. amazonaws.com. (For instance, the object customer01. dat in the bucket custorder can be accessed as http://custorder. s3.amazonaws. com/customer01. dat.) The most typical procedures in S3 are: produce (as well as name) a pail, create a things, by defining its trick, as well as optionally an accessibility control list for that things, reviewed an object, delete an object, and also, checklist the tricks had in among the pails.

Thin tables are a new standard of storage space monitoring for structured and also semi-structured data that has arised in current years, specifically after the rate of interest generated by Google's Bigtable. (Bigtable is the storage system behind much of Google's applications as well as is revealed, using APIs, to Google Application Engine designers.) A sporadic table is a collection of data documents, every one having a row as well as a collection of column identifiers, so that at the sensible level documents behave like the rows of a table.

Additional inserts do not necessarily need to conform to these schemas, but also for the purpose of our instance we will certainly assume they do. Since Simple, DB does not implement signs up with, joins should be coded at the client application degree. To obtain the orders for all NY clients, an application would initially fetch the client info by means of the question: select id from Clients where state ='NY' the outcome of which would certainly include C043 as well as would certainly after that obtain the equivalent orders as follows: select * from Orders where cid= 'C043' A significant limitation for Simple, DB is that the size of a table circumstances is bounded.

Individuals can develop brand-new data sources from scratch or migrate their existing My, SQL data right into the Amazon cloud. Microsoft has a comparable offering with SQL Azure, but chooses a various technique that supports scaling by physically separating and also replicating sensible database instances on several machines. A SQL Azure source can be service-enabled by publishing an OData service on top of it, as in the area "Service-Enabling Information Shops." Google's Megastore is likewise made to provide scalable as well as reputable storage space for cloud applications, while enabling customers to design their data in a SQL-like schema language.

Information service updates and deals. Just like various other applications, applications built over data solutions need transactional homes in order to run appropriately in the presence of simultaneous procedures, exemptions, and solution failings.

Propagating information solution updates to the proper source(s) can be dealt with for a few of the typical situations by examining the family tree of the published data, that is, computing the inverse mapping from the service check out back to the underlying data resources based on the solution sight definition.2,8 In some situations this is not possible, either because of problems comparable to non-updatability of relational views 6,33 or as a result of the existenceof opaque practical information sources such as Internet service phone calls, in which instance hints or hand-operated coding would be needed for an information services system to know just how to back-map any appropriate information changes. According to Helland et al., designers of really scalable applications have no actual choice however to handle the lack of transactional assurances throughout machines and also with repeated messages sent out in between entities. In technique, there are several consistency designs that share this approach. The most basic model is eventual consistency, initially defined in Terry et al. Finally, RDBMSs in the cloud(Megastore, SQL Azure)provide ACID semioticsunder the constraint that a purchase may touch only one entity. This is made certain by requiring all tables entailed in a transaction to share the exact same dividing trick. Furthermore, Megastore provides assistance for transactional messaging in between entities using lines up and for explicit two-phase dedicate. An essential aspect of data services that is underdeveloped in current product or services offerings, yet exceptionally important, is data protection. Internet service safety and security alone is not adequate, as control over that can invoke which service calls is simply one aspect of the trouble for information services. Provided a collection of information services, as well as the data over which they are developed, a data solution engineer requires to be able to specify gain access to control policies that govern which users can do and/or see what and also where data services. Sections of the details returned by a data service phone call can be encrypted, replaced, or entirely elided (schema permitting )from the call's outcomes. Much more broadly, much work has actually been performed in the areas of accessibility control, security, and also privacy for data sources, and also much of it uses to information services.
